Located in Heguri, 8.9 km from Higashiosaka Hanazono Rugby Stadium, natomi宿 provides rooms with air conditioning and free WiFi. This recently renovated guest house is located 11 km from Iwafune Shrine and 13 km from Nara Station. The accommodation offers a shared kitchen and a shared lounge for guests. The units at the guest house are equipped with a shared bathroom and bed linen. An Asian breakfast is available at the guest house. A bicycle rental service is available at natomi宿. Suehiro Park is 14 km from the accommodation, while Nozaki Kannon Shrine is 14 km away. Itami Airport is 39 km from the property.
